Fragments preserving lower border of blue, red and black bands, with incised lines between the bands, immediately above the preserved lower edge of plaster. On white ground above the border are parts of two nautili proceeding to left; one is yellow with aquamarine tentacles; the other is aquamarine with tentacles that are more red than yellow.
